Position Title: CNC Machine Operator - Night Shift
Reports to: Machine Shop Manager
Job Location: Norwich, KS
Employment Type: Full-time
Hours: Monday – Thursday (4:30p – 3:00a)
Job Overview:
The CNC Machine Operator is responsible for operating Computer Numerical Control (CNC) machinery to produce high-precision parts and components.
They work closely with engineers and production teams to ensure that parts meet exact specifications, quality standards, and are produced in a timely manner.
The role requires strong technical skills, and attention to detail.
Key Responsibilities:
+ Operation:
+ Operate CNC milling, lathe, and other automated machinery.
+ Verify the machine's operation by conducting test runs and adjustments.
+ Quality Control:
+ Inspect finished parts to ensure they meet design specifications using measuring tools such as calipers, micrometers, and gauges.
+ Perform in-process inspections to ensure consistent product quality.
+ Record and report any defects or quality issues.
+ Blueprint Reading and Interpretation:
+ Read and interpret blueprints, and technical drawings to understand the specifications of parts.
+ Adjust machine settings based on the machining process and material properties.
+ Tooling and Material Selection:
+ Choose appropriate cutting tools, fixtures, and materials based on the product specifications and desired tolerances.
+ Replace worn or damaged tools as necessary to maintain product quality.
+ Documentation and Reporting:
+ Maintain accurate records of production runs, tool usage, machine settings, and inspection results.
+ Report production status, delays, or machine malfunctions to supervisors or managers.
+ Safety and Compliance:
+ Follow all safety protocols and adhere to company policies and regulations.
+ Ensure machines are used in a safe and responsible manner to prevent accidents or damage to equipment.
+ Collaboration:
+ Work with engineers, production teams, and other departments to optimize machine performance and improve manufacturing processes.
Required Skills & Qualifications:
+ High school diploma or equivalent; technical certification or apprenticeship in machining or related field preferred.
+ Proven experience operating CNC machinery (3-axis, 4-axis, or multi-axis machines) preferred.
+ Proficiency in reading technical drawings, and blueprints.
+ Strong understanding of CNC programming languages such as G-code is helpful.
+ Experience with precision measuring instruments (micrometers, calipers, etc.) is helpful.
+ Familiarity with quality control standards and inspection methods.
+ Excellent problem-solving and troubleshooting skills.
+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
+ Strong attention to detail and commitment to producing high-quality work.
Physical Requirements:
+ Ability to lift up to 50 pounds.
+ Must be able to stand for extended periods.
+ Frequent bending, reaching, and handling of heavy materials.
+ Good hand-eye coordination and manual dexterity.
Work Environment:
+ Work is performed in a manufacturing setting, with exposure to loud noises, dust, and machinery.
+ Personal protective equipment (PPE) is required.
